The weekend is almost upon us and what better way to spend the free days than sinking our time into an epic RPG, especially as it is free to download.

No catch.

Without needing a PlayStation Plus subscription, PlayStation 5 users can download this free-to-play RPG which has taken the world by storm since it was first released back in 2013.

Advert

Check out Path of Exile in action below!

Since then, the game has gone on to receive a sequel but with some players admitting that they still prefer the original, it is definitely worth making use of this free download.

The game is Path of Exile, an action RPG set in a dark fantasy world.

Advert

Developed by Grinding Gear Games, Path of Exile puts you in the shoes of an Exile who is struggling to survive on the dark continent of Wraeclast.

However, you must get stronger if you wish to enact revenge on those who wronged you.

“Earn devastating skills and valuable items as you fight your way through the dark continent of Wraeclast. With unrivaled character customization, Path of Exile is an award-winning online Action RPG created by hardcore gamers, for hardcore gamers,” the official PlayStation description reads.

In December 2024, Path of Exile 2 was released in early access thanks to the success of its predecessor but there is no denying that the original game has captured the hearts of millions of fans.

Advert

Path of Exile still sits at a ‘very positive’ rating on Steam with reviews praising its hardcore gameplay, co-op support, and endless possibilities.

“One of the best ARPGs out there, and it’s free,” one positive review read.

Another read: “Not a game for the weak willed or the casual.

It will take persistence to just deal with the basics, and commitment to master. But for those that do master it, this is a game of near endless possibilities.

Advert

Lots of room to tinker and experiment with characters and classes. You will hold the power. Do you have what it takes to wield it effectively?”
